Welcome to Crittenden's Retail Tentants
PREVIEW ONLY
Interior Magic
Locations: 57
Business Name: Interior Magic
Parent Company: Interior Magic
Headquarters: Lexington, NC
Business: Auto Accessories/Parts/Service
Property: Freestanding Pad... and more.
Growth : New Locations